SeaLink: Charting a More Accessible Course with Tech

August 14, 2025

Summary

Sealink, a major ferry operator in the UK and Ireland, is making significant strides in improving accessibility for all passengers, particularly those with mobility challenges. Recognizing that travel shouldn't be a barrier for anyone, Sealink is investing heavily in technology and operational changes to enhance the passenger experience. This isn't just about compliance; it's a proactive approach to inclusivity.
The company's efforts are multifaceted. They're implementing digital tools to provide clearer and more accessible information about accessibility features on their vessels and at ports. This includes detailed online resources, potentially including virtual tours and 3D models, allowing passengers to understand the layout and available facilities before they travel. They are also focusing on improving the physical environment, ensuring ramps, lifts, and accessible restrooms are readily available and well-maintained.
Crucially, Sealink is investing in staff training to ensure crew members are equipped to assist passengers with diverse needs. This includes training on communication strategies, assistance with boarding and disembarking, and understanding different types of mobility aids. The company is also exploring the use of AI and other smart technologies to further streamline processes and provide personalized support.
The overarching goal is to create a seamless and stress-free travel experience for everyone, regardless of their physical abilities. Sealink's commitment to accessibility reflects a growing industry-wide awareness of the importance of inclusivity and a willingness to invest in solutions that benefit all travelers. This approach could serve as a model for other ferry operators and transportation providers seeking to enhance their services and reach a wider audience.
